Neil Lollar has been named the next head football coach at Hancock High School. He replaces Rocky Gaudin after four decades of coaching along the Gulf Coast, stepping in from his role as defensive coordinator last season.

The Lady Bulldogs were looking for their second straight win to start the year against yet another team they lost to in 2016. The Lady Bulldogs hang on to win a close one over LSUE by the count of 58-54.

Biloxi hosted Pearl River Central in high school boys soccer tonight. The Indians go onto take this one at home for their 10th win of the year, 6-0.

Long Beach hosted West Harrison tonight, a pair of region 8 teams that somehow avoided one another in the Gulfport Hardwood Holiday Classic. Long Beach goes on to win a close one by the final score of 42-39.

In the second game of the day at the Gulfport Hardwood Holiday Classic, West Harrison and Long Beach got together. Both teams looking for their first win of the tournament. The Bearcats hang on to win this one 71-67.
